Abstract

The utility model provides a double-screen face verification terminal which comprises a base, a face image acquisition module for acquiring face characteristic information and a display which is integrally connected with the base and displays an image which is acquired and represents the face characteristic information, wherein the display comprises a visitor display screen and a management display screen, the visitor display screen and the management display screen are used for synchronously displaying the image, the respective display plates of the two display screens form an included angle with a horizontal plane, the horizontal distance of the bottoms of the two display plates is larger than the horizontal distance of the tops of the two display plates, and the face image acquisition module is arranged above the display plates of the visitor display screen. Through setting the display to two display screens, two-sided screen can provide more comprehensive information show and operation, lets the user know system behavior, authentication state, operating procedure etc. more directly perceivedly, can also embody simultaneously and put direction and state, and the visitor also can directly perceived obtain the state suggestion when authentication is passed, improves operation convenience and user satisfaction.

Technical Field
The utility model relates to the technical field of security equipment, in particular to a double-screen face verification terminal.
Background
With the continuous development of modern technology, biometric identification technology is becoming one of the mainstream technologies in the security authentication field. The multi-mode biological feature recognition technology is a recognition technology based on a plurality of biological features, improves the recognition rate by integrating the plurality of biological features, and has higher safety and robustness. In practical applications, multi-modal biometric technologies are widely used, such as face recognition, fingerprint recognition, iris recognition, document recognition, etc.
The multi-mode biological characteristic recognition terminal system can mainly recognize the relevant authentication of visitor visiting information at present, acquire visitor reservation information through an identity card reading and face recognition mode, enable the visitor to pass through after complete information verification, and can reasonably configure and integrate specific application scenes, so that a comprehensive, intelligent and efficient recognition scheme is provided.
The prior face verification terminal comprises a base, a display screen and a camera, wherein a visitor face characteristic image is acquired through the camera, acquired image information is displayed through the display screen or is operated by a manager, however, most face verification terminals are provided with the display screen and are oriented to the manager, the visitor cannot see verification progress and state, and face recognition verification efficiency and customer satisfaction are low.

Referring to fig. 1, fig. 1 basically shows the structure of a two-screen face verification terminal of the present utility model. The dual-screen face verification terminal 100 is used for collecting the face feature information of the visitor and displaying the corresponding image for identifying and judging the identity of the visitor, and completing the face recognition function. The double-screen face verification terminal is provided with two display screens, the front screen is used for displaying the identity information and the authentication state of the visitor, the back screen is used for displaying the placement state and the operation flow, and the visitor can intuitively obtain the state prompt in the authentication process, so that the user satisfaction is improved. Meanwhile, the double-sided screen design can be better suitable for various placement modes and environments, and the display effect and the screen occupancy rate are improved.
In one embodiment, the dual-screen face verification terminal 100 includes a base 10, a face image acquisition module 30 for acquiring face feature information, and a display 20 integrally connected with the base and displaying an image of the acquired face feature information, where the display 20 includes a visitor display 22 and a management display 21, the visitor display and the management display are used for synchronously displaying the image, the respective display panels of the two displays form an included angle with a horizontal plane, and the horizontal distance of the bottoms of the two display panels is greater than the horizontal distance of the top, and the face image acquisition module is disposed above the display panels of the visitor display.
In one embodiment, the angle between the display panel of the guest-side display screen 22 and the horizontal plane is smaller than the angle between the display panel of the management-side display screen 21 and the horizontal plane.
Through setting up visitor's end display screen 22 inclination and being greater than the inclination of management end display screen 21, make things convenient for the visitor to carry out face identification, improve user's use experience.
In one embodiment, the display 20 includes a display housing and a display panel, wherein the front and rear sides of the display housing are respectively provided with a display panel mounting position, and the display panel is embedded in the display panel mounting position.
In one embodiment, the base 10 is connected to the display housing by a support arm 40.
In one embodiment, the support arm 40 is provided with one support arm 40, and the support arm 40 connects the base 10 with the display 20 at one end of the base 10 in the length direction, and one end of the display 20 is suspended above the base. The display is supported by a supporting arm, the appearance modeling accords with the ergonomic principle, the appearance modeling is more reasonable, the display can better adapt to different running environments, the display is more coordinated and consistent with the surrounding decoration environment, and the overall acceptance is improved.
In one embodiment, the support arm is hollow, and the power line and the signal transmission line between the base and the display are accommodated in the support arm.
In one embodiment, the display housing, the support arm and the base are integrally formed, so that the display housing, the support arm and the base are convenient to assemble and improve structural strength and tightness.
In one embodiment, the projection of the display onto the base covers the base.
In one embodiment, the base, the support arm and the display define a card swiping area therebetween.
In one embodiment, the card-swiping area 50 is internally provided with the card-holding groove 11, the card-holding groove is formed in the upper surface of the base, and the card is conveniently and rapidly and accurately placed by a visitor through the card-holding groove, so that the reading speed of identity information of the visitor is improved, the efficiency of identity authentication is improved, and the use experience of a user is further improved.
